In an electrifying revelation, the inaugural FIFA Futsal Men's World Ranking has crowned Brazil as the leader, with Portugal snapping closely at their heels for the second spot. The rankings have thrown the spotlight on surprising powerhouses: Morocco, Thailand, and France are soaring high, staking their claims among the elite.


Brazil reigns supreme at the zenith of this new ranking system, edging out traditional powerhouses. Portugal has narrowly ousted Spain for the silver position, while IR Iran and Argentina round out the formidable top five.


This lineup promises high stakes for the upcoming FIFA Futsal World Cup™ draw, where these top five, alongside host nation Uzbekistan, will dominate Pot 1. Not to be overlooked, Pot 2 features a mix of emerging and established futsal nations including Morocco, Kazakhstan, Thailand, France, Ukraine, and Paraguay. Spotlight on the globe: New Zealand marks its spot as the 19th, leading the charge for the OFC, while Costa Rica claims the 31st position, topping Concacaf's list.

Hot Off the Press: Brazil Dominates FIFA Futsal Men’s World Rankings!


Brazil is setting the futsal world ablaze, clinching the top spot in the latest FIFA Futsal Men’s World Rankings! Fresh off their bronze medal performance at the 2021 global finals, Brazil has been unstoppable. They showcased their prowess with consecutive wins against Spain last year and recently reclaimed the Futsal Copa America title from Argentina this past February.


The spotlight shines on Pito, heralded as the world's premier futsal talent, and Ferrao, a three-time recipient of the sport’s Best Player award, who has made a triumphant return from ACL surgery. Futsal Fever: Portugal's Unstoppable Rise and Rivals on the Chase!


Portugal is tearing up the futsal record books, clinching the top spot at Lithuania 2021, securing back-to-back UEFA Futsal EURO titles, and winning the inaugural Futsal Finalissima. Under Jorge Braz’s strategic genius, stars like Andre Coelho, Tomas Paco, Erick Mendonca, Pany Varela, and the phenomenally talented Zicky Te are making waves across the futsal world.


Not to be overshadowed, Spain, with two world titles to their name, have faced narrow defeats to Portugal in recent major finals but have bounced back with impressive friendly performances, including a resounding 6-0 victory over their Iberian neighbors. Under the guidance of Coach Fede Vidal, talents such as Chino, Adolfo Fernandez, and Miguel Mellado are keeping Spain in the fierce competition.


Meanwhile, Iran, finishing third at Colombia 2016 after knocking out Brazil, continues to impress on the global stage with a recent triumph at the AFC Futsal Asian Cup. Vahid Shamsaei’s squad, featuring standout players like Asghar Hassanzadeh, Moslem Oladghobad, and Hossein Tayyebi, showcases Iran as a formidable force with some of the world's best players holding court in their positions. 2024 Futsal World Cup participants -September 14 to October 6, 2024

1st – Brazil

2nd – Portugal

3rd – Spain

4th – IR Iran

5th – Argentina

6th – Morocco

8th – Kazakhstan

9th – Thailand

10th – France

11th – Uzbekistan

12th – Ukraine

13th – Paraguay

16th – Croatia

19th – New Zealand

21st – Venezuela

30th – Afghanistan

31st – Costa Rica

34th – Tajikistan

36th – Netherlands

40th – Guatemala

44th – Panama

47th – Angola

50th – Libya

78th – Cuba
